Course Details

Introduction to AI-Driven Hybrid Vehicle Solutions: Understanding AI's role in hybrid vehicle operations and benefits.
Fundamentals of Electric & Hybrid Vehicle Technologies: Exploring traditional and modern hybrid architectures, batteries, and power electronics.
AI Algorithms & Machine Learning Techniques: Applying AI methods for optimizing energy consumption and predictive maintenance.
Data Analysis & Modeling for Hybrid Vehicles: Collecting, processing, and interpreting vehicle data for AI-driven decision-making.
AI-Based Energy Management Systems: Implementing AI-driven energy management for improved efficiency.
Connectivity & V2X Communications: Integrating hybrid vehicles with smart infrastructure and advanced driver-assistance systems (ADAS).
AI for Autonomous Driving Applications: Applying AI to enhance self-driving capabilities in hybrid vehicles.
Regulations & Standards in AI-Driven Hybrid Vehicles: Compliance with global automotive and AI regulations.
Cybersecurity in AI-Driven Hybrid Vehicles: Securing AI-based systems against cyber threats.
Future Trends in AI-Driven Hybrid Vehicle Solutions: Anticipating emerging technologies and innovations.
